Генератор прямоугольных импульсов Советский патент 1986 года по МПК H03K3/64 

Описание патента на изобретение SU1270880A1

6

Изобретение относится к импульсной технике и может быть использовано в системах автоматического уп ра-вления, контрольно-измерительных устройствах.

Цель изобретения - повышение быстродействия и расширение функциональньпс возможностей устройства за счет программного управления ко-гшчеством импульсов в серии.

На чертеже приведена структурная схема генератора прямоугольных импульсов .

Устройство содержит генератор,1 опорной частоты, первый триггер 2 элемент И 3, счетчик 4 импульсов, элемент ИЛИ 5, программный блок 6, элемент НЕ 7, второй триггер 8, управляющую шину 9, выходные пины 10

и 11.

Выход генератора 1 опорной частоты соединен с первым входом элемента И 3, второй вход которого подключен к прямому выходу триггера 2, а выход соединен со счетным входом счетчика 4 импульсов,, информационные входы которого подключены к N выходам программного блока 6, выход которого соединен с первым входом триггера 2, инверсный выход которого подключен к входу начальной.установки программного блока 6 и второму входу триггера 8, выходы которого соединены с выходными шинами 10 и 11, а вход подключен к выходу счетчика импульсов и второму входу элемента ИЛИ 5, первый вход которого соединен с управляющей шиной 9 и вторым входом триггера 2j а выход элемента ИЛИ 5 подключен к входу записи счетчика 4 и «пульсов и через элемент НЕ 7 к управляющему входу программного блока 6, Последний может быть выполнен в вцце программируемого запоминающего устройства.

Устройство работает следующим образом.

В исходном состоянии на прямом выходе триггера 2 присутствует уровень логического О, который запрещает прохождение импульсов с выхода генератора 1 на выход элемента И 3, Одновременно на инверсном выходе триггера 2 присутствует уровень логической 1, который устанавливает программный блок 6 и триггер 8 в начальное состояние. Соответственно

программный блок 6 выдает на информационные входы счетчика 4 код первого временного интервала. На прямом выходе триггера 8 устанавливается логический О, а на инверсном выходе логическая 1, В этом состоянии устройство находится до прихода по управляющей шине 9 запускающего импульса,

Передний положительный фронт запускающего импульса, пройдя через элемент ИЛИ 5., осуществляет запись в счетчик 4 параллельного N-разрядного кода первого временного интервала, который уже установлен на информационных входах счетчика 4.Соответственно задний отрицательный фронт запускающего импульса с выхода элемента ИЛИ 5 поступает на вход элемента НЕ .7 и, став положительным на выходе элемента НЕ, поступает на управляющий вход программного блока 6, который ,по этому фронту выдает на первые выходы параллельньй код следующего временного интервала.

По переднему фронту запускающего импульса также, происходит установка триггера 2 и на его прямом выходе появляется уровень логической 1,

разрешая прохождение на выход элемента И 3 импульсов с генератора 1.

Эти импульсы с выхода элемента И 3 поступают насчетный вход счетчика 4, в которьш уже занесен код длительности первого временного интервала. По заполнении счетчика 4 на его выходе появляется импульс.По переднему фронту этого импульса триггер 8 устанавливается в единичное состояние, одновременно передний фронт, пройдя через элемент ИЛИ 5, производит запись в счетчик 4 кода длительности следующего временного

интервала. Этот код уже присутствовал на информационных входах счетчика 4, поскольку программный блок 6 выставил его по заднему фронту запускающего импульса.

Кроме того, .задний отрицательный фронт импульса с выхода счетчика 4, пройдя через элемент ИЛИ 5, элемент НЕ 7, становится положительнь1м и поступает на управляющий вход

программного блока 6, который по этому фронту задает код следующего временного интервала на информа1щонные входы счетчика 4. 3 Таким образом, программньш блок. во время формирования счетчиком заданного временного интервала производит считывание и вьщачу на информационные входы счетчика 4 кода сле дующего временного интервала. Занесение этого кода непосредственно в счетчик 4 осуществляется после окон чания формирования временного интер вала, заданного до этого. Триггер 8, деля импульсы с выход счетчика 4 формирует на своих выход ных шинах 10 и 11 две противофазные последовательности импульсов, длительность и период у которых регулируется независимо. Устройство будет генерировать последовательность импульсов до тех пор, пока на (N+1)-M выходе програм много блока не появится логическая 1. Эта единица поступит на первый вход триггера 2 и установит на его прямом выходе логический О, который запретит прохождение импульсов на счетчик 4. Одновременно на инверсном выходе триггера 2 установит ся логическая 1, которая вернет программный блок 6 и триггер 8 в исходное состояние, в котором устройство будет находиться до поступления запускающего импульса по шине 9 Если в (N+1)-й разряд программного блока 6 по всем ячейкам записать логический О или отключить второй вход триггера 2 от выхода (N+1)-ro разряда, то устройство будет генерировать непрерывную последовательность импульсов. В устройстве совмещается во времени отработка счетчиком заданного кода длительности и выборка и вьщача из программного блока кода длитель80ности следующего временного интервала. Запись логической 1 в (N+1)-M разряде программного блока обеспечивает управляемый режим генерации пачек импульсов с программно-задаваемым числом импульсов в пачке. Формула изобретения Генератор прямоугольных импульсов , содержащий генератор опорной частоты, выход которого соединен с первым входом элемента И, второй вход Которого подключен к прямому выходу первого триггера, а выход соединен со счетным входом счетчика импульсов, информационные входы которого подключены к N выходам программного блока, а выход счетчика импульсов соединен с первым входом второго триггера, выходы которого подключены к выходным шинам, о т л ичающийся тем, что, с целью повьшения быстродействия и расширения функциональных возможностей, в него введены элемент ИЛИ и элемент НЕ, вход которого соединен с выходом элемента ИЛИ и входом записи счетчика импульсов, а выход элемента НЕ подключен к управляющему входу программного блока, (Н+1)-й выход которого соединен с первым входом первого триггера, инверсный выход которого подключен к входу начальной ycTaHOBKjf программного блока и второму входу второго триггера, при этом вторюй вход первого триггера соединен с управляющей шиной и пер- . вым входом элемента ИЛИ, второй вход которого подключен к выходу счетчика импульсов.

Похожие патенты SU1270880A1

название год авторы номер документа
ГЕНЕРАТОР ПРЯМОУГОЛЬНЫХ ИМПУЛЬСОВ 1999
  • Коечкин Н.Н.
  • Погорельский С.Л.
  • Рублев Н.Н.
  • Шипунов А.Г.
RU2150783C1
ГЕНЕРАТОР ПРЯМОУГОЛЬНЫХ ИМПУЛЬСОВ 1998
  • Шипунов А.Г.
  • Погорельский С.Л.
  • Телышев В.А.
  • Матвеев Э.Л.
  • Коечкин Н.Н.
  • Долотова В.В.
RU2125341C1
ГЕНЕРАТОР ПРЯМОУГОЛЬНЫХ ИМПУЛЬСОВ 2004
  • Бутенко Алексей Иванович
  • Погорельский Семен Львович
  • Коечкин Николай Николаевич
  • Долгов Вячеслав Васильевич
RU2276456C1
Генератор прямоугольных импульсов 2021
  • Бондарь Олег Григорьевич
  • Брежнева Екатерина Олеговна
  • Сизонов Иван Игоревич
  • Поляков Николай Владимирович
RU2759439C1
ГЕНЕРАТОР ПРЯМОУГОЛЬНЫХ ИМПУЛЬСОВ 2002
  • Бушмелев Н.И.
  • Бутенко А.И.
  • Коечкин Н.Н.
  • Лазукин В.Ф.
  • Майборода В.Ф.
  • Погорельский С.Л.
RU2212097C1
Программное реле времени 1988
  • Бочков Сергей Анатольевич
SU1653020A1
Устройство для формирования временных интервалов 1985
  • Квурт Леонид Семенович
  • Котляров Владимир Леонидович
  • Титков Валерий Михайлович
SU1272486A1
МОДУЛЬ СИСТЕМЫ ПРОГРАММНОГО УПРАВЛЕНИЯ 1998
  • Зотов И.В.
RU2145434C1
Программное устройство для фиксации и документирования времени 1989
  • Глебович Вячеслав Геннадьевич
  • Антипин Михаил Алексеевич
SU1677691A1
Измеритель временных параметров случайных импульсных потоков 1988
  • Новиков Евгений Владимирович
  • Степурко Виктор Михайлович
SU1575135A1

Реферат патента 1986 года Генератор прямоугольных импульсов

Изобретение относится к импульсной технике. Может быть использовано в системах автоматического управления и контрольно-измерительных устройствах. Цель изобретения - расширение функциональных возможностей и повьш1ение быстродействия. ДостигаетСя за счет программного управления количеством импульсов в серии. Для этого в генератор прямоугольных импульсов дополнительно введены элемент ИЛИ 5 и элемент НЕ 7. Устройство также содержит генератор 1 опорной частоты, триггеры 2 и 8, элемент И -3, счетчик 4 импульсов, программный блок 6, шины: управляющую 9 и выходные 10 и 11. Программный блок 6 может быть выполнен в виде программируемого запоминающего устройства. В устройстве обеспечивается программно-управляемое генерирование пачек импульсов с программноi задаваемым числом импульсов в пачке. 1 ил. (Л о о 00 00

Формула изобретения SU 1 270 880 A1

Документы, цитированные в отчете о поиске Патент 1986 года SU1270880A1

Генератор последовательности импульсов 1980
  • Гудилин Владимир Владимирович
  • Модринский Владимир Михайлович
SU949786A1
Переносная печь для варки пищи и отопления в окопах, походных помещениях и т.п. 1921
  • Богач Б.И.
SU3A1

SU 1 270 880 A1

Авторы

Горшков Александр Николаевич

Даты

1986-11-15Публикация

1985-06-21Подача